The team is currently focusing on the product itself and version 1.0 is coming out very soon.  Have you seen our latest update? https://medium.com/fortknoxster/fortknoxster-update-towards-the-launch-of-version-1-0-d881eecea20c

The listing fee is not always the problem, but there are a lot of hidden fees/services that they offer after the initial stage. The key is this; that even if we are getting listed, you probably know that they want a certain amount of volume for a while. That is also not always the problem neither. If those huge volumes are not there for a while, you can get delisted and that is not a good thing, you/we lose a lot of money/credibility. So, in the best interest of you/me/us (we all want the same), we have to take our time to make a good-for the long-term decision.
